Software Upgrades

Please read the following instructions carefully before downloading your software.

Upgrading the software on your controller is easy! All you need is a 32 MB (or higher) USB flash memory stick. (*Note: If you have a DMT7, DMB7 or DGI7, these are no longer supported).

Determine your upgrade from the appropriate tab then follow these instructions:

  1. Click on the link on the left to access the applicable software upgrade link for your product, then click on the upgrade link. A dialog box will open, asking if you want to save or open the file. Choose “Save As”. In XP and Vista, save it to your desktop (this makes it easy to find). In Windows 7 & 8 & 10, the file is saved in your “Downloads” folder.
  2. Plug in your USB flash drive. The drive window should open. If not, go to “My Computer”, and open it (should be “Removable Media” drive).
  3. Drag the Software Upgrade over to the USB drive. (Make sure that the Upgrade is the only file on the drive.)
  4. Unplug the USB flash drive from the computer.

Upload the software to your WebMasterONE:

  1. Plug the memory stick into the USB Host connection on the controller. The stick will only fit in one direction.
  2. Enter the Software Upgrade Menu and start the upgrade.
  3. The screen will indicate that the upgrade has started. Once it finishes (in a few minutes) the controller will reboot.
  4. Remove the memory stick. This may be used to upgrade as many controllers as you would like.

WebMasters with a USB connector purchased after April 2007 (with Serial Numbers starting with 070405xxxx or higher) include a Style C core board.

These instructions also apply to WebMasters with a USB connector purchased before April 2007 (with Serial numbers starting with 070405xxxx or lower) but have been upgraded with a Style C core board.

Note that Style C core boards DO NOT have a large 1″ black component on it. (Photo shows Style C component)

WebMasters with a USB connector purchased before April 2007 (with Serial Numbers before 070405xxxx) include a style B core board. These core boards will have a large 1” square black component on it. (See photo) It is necessary to replace the core and core interface boards (WebMaster) to upgrade to the current hardware and software.
